    archive.php template file is supposed to display all kind of archive lists…
    You can edit the The Loop in it to show only the titles (by deleting the_content tag) and by setting the proper parameters in the archive tag you should be able to get waht you want.

    Just a note. For a beginner blogger this might seem a bright idea… but what will happen when you’ll have 527 posts? Show them all on ONE single page? Not very userfriendly. There is a reason humankind invented categorization and chronological delimiters 🙂
